A very fine and large Chinese Republic period famille-rose porcelain vase, delicately potted of an elegant baluster form with a trumpet neck and the body tapered gently towards the splayed foot, superbly painted with an elderly scholar and his two young attendants in a garden scene, with rockworks, pine trees and two magpies hovering above, the neatly finished foot rim exposing a fine paste characteristic of the Republic period ware, interior and underside glazed white, center of the base neatly inscribed with the Hongxian reign mark in iron-red. (Wooden stand not included). DATE : Chinese, early 20th Century, Republic period.
MARK : iron-red four-character Hongxian on base.
SIZE : approximately 13 1/2" (34.3 cm) high.
CONDITION : perfect condition with very minor enamel wear only. No chips, no cracks, and no repairs.
